POSITION

DESCRIPTION
Position Title:

Diploma Qualified Early Childhood Educator

Directorate:

Community Development

Department:

Youth, Early Years and Families

Unit:

Kindergarten Services

Classification:

Diploma Qualified Early Childhood Educator

Position Objective
Work with fellow educators to provide Kindergarten aged children with a high quality
Kindergarten program designed to meet the individual and group needs in accordance with
the National Quality Framework (NQF).

Key Responsibilities

Support, deliver and maintain a high quality program in accordance with the National Quality
Framework (NQF) inclusive of the Education and Care Services National Law Act, the
Education and Care Services National Regulations, the approved Early Learning Frameworks of
Australia, the National Quality Standards and Rating and Assessment.
To work in close partnership with the Kindergarten Teacher and co-educators to support,
prepare, implement and evaluate a high quality program that reflects the Service philosophy,
Kindergarten Team Culture plan, and Policies and Procedures of Wyndham City Councils
Kindergarten Service.
Assist the Teacher with completing documentation, observations, reflections and planning.
To stand in as the room leader in the absence of the Teacher.
Create a warm, welcoming, flexible and inclusive environment where supportive and
respectful partnerships with all families are paramount.
Support the participation of all children within a high quality Kindergarten program, inclusive
of children with additional needs.
Work in partnership with families to enable them to contribute to service decisions,
participation in the kindergarten community and actively contribute to their childs learning
and development in a meaningful way.
Develop strong relationships with families that provide support, guidance and information
that is easily accessible and reliable, and ensures connections with the local community as
required.
Maintain a professional workplace with colleagues, where open communication, respectful
debate and professional practice is promoted to continuously improve the program for the
benefit of children and their families.

-2

Participate in a range of professional development training opportunities to maintain, improve


and broaden individual professional knowledge and skills.
Assist in the centre administration requirements on behalf of Wyndham City and the
Department of Education and Early Childhood Development (DEECD) as required.
Responsible for maintaining a high quality standard of hygiene and service relevant current
regulation requirements.
Carry out other duties commensurate with skills and abilities as deemed reasonable and
appropriate to the role as directed from time to time.

Qualifications and Experience

Diploma in Childrens Services with relevant experience in an early years setting.


Thorough understanding and sound knowledge of the legislative requirements, regulations,
developmental frameworks and the NQF.
Thorough understanding and the ability to implement the requirements of the NQF: inclusive
of the Education and Care Services National Law Act, the Education and Care Services National
Regulations, the approved Early Learning Frameworks of Australia, the National Quality
Standards and Rating and Assessment
Demonstrated ability to implement high quality early years educational programs.
Demonstrated experience with completing documentation, observations, reflections and
planning.
Demonstrated experience as a room leader.
Working with Childrens Check.
Current ACECQA approved First Aid Certificate (including CPR).
Current ACECQA approved First Aid Management of Anaphylaxis Certificate.
Current ACECQA approved Emergency Asthma Management Certificate.
Current Drivers Licence is desirable.
